[問題] js 中如何只去掉頭尾全型空白

看板Ajax作者 (你不夠資深喔!)時間15年前 (2010/09/28 11:01), 編輯推噓0(005)
留言5則, 2人參與, 最新討論串1/1
在 javascript 中 要如何只去掉頭尾全型空白 而不去掉非空白字元中間的全型空白呢 " 我是字 我是字 " 中間那段不去掉 頭尾去掉 該怎麼寫 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 203.83.216.112 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 203.83.216.112 ※ 編輯: kkk5566 來自: 203.83.216.112 (09/28 11:01)

09/28 15:53, , 1F
用 regex + replace
09/28 15:53, 1F

09/28 15:53, , 2F
如果你有用jQuery可以簡單用 $.trim(str) 處理
09/28 15:53, 2F

09/28 15:54, , 3F
return (text || "").replace( rtrim, "" );
09/28 15:54, 3F

09/28 15:54, , 4F
rtrim = /^(\s|\u00A0)+|(\s|\u00A0)+$/g
09/28 15:54, 4F

09/28 20:34, , 5F
09/28 20:34, 5F
文章代碼(AID): #1CeLfoq7 (Ajax)
文章代碼(AID): #1CeLfoq7 (Ajax)